A Word From the Maitre d’

My Name is Tom Merighi, Jr. I am the President of Merighi’s Savoy Inn. My job is to make sure your wedding day runs smoothly from start to finish. Actually, our dealings start with the first meeting right after your engagement. You get to deal with me directly right through the whole reception planning process. We meet to discuss menu selections, floor plan options, and proper protocol.
Then the day of your wedding finally arrives. My day begins by setting your room according to the floor plan that you return to us. I actually go around to each seat to ensure that everyone will be comfortable and have a nice view. Once the room is set, flowers, decorations, and wedding cakes begin to arrive.
When the reception begins, I am right there to greet your guests and to make sure that every detail is perfectly carried out. I personally orchestrate your introductions, blessing, first dance, and toast. This means that I am there to make sure that this part of the reception runs smoothly and without mistake. Many places do not provide a maitre d’ and this can cause confusion and leave an important part of the evening up to chance.
You can rest assured that at the Savoy, WE, personally handle and coordinate the special events. We take care of the escorting during the introductions, the special dances, the cake cutting ceremony, and even the garter and bouquet festivities. Of course, we work in conjunction with your entertainment and photographers.
Also, every one of your guests will know who is in charge of your reception if they have a special need or request.
